Hi Michael,

There is no need to insert a formula and subsequently delete it. It is also
rarely necessary to activate sheets.

Try, instead:

'<<=============
Sub MAM()
Dim nStuff As String
Dim ThisSheet As String
Dim i As Long

ThisSheet = ActiveSheet.Name

nStuff = InputBox _
("What date is this for? I.E 1/1/2006,1/5/2006 etc.")

Application.ScreenUpdating = False
Workbooks.Open Filename:="\\server2\mam.xls"

With Worksheets("Jan 06")
'Now working in the MAM Sheet
i = Application.CountIf(.Columns(2), nStuff)
End With

Workbooks("January Stats.xls"). _
Worksheets(ThisSheet).Range("B44").Value = i

ActiveWorkbook.Close False
Application.ScreenUpdating = True

End Sub
'<<=============
